Members celebrate the best of the UK’s logistics industry

July 24, 2017

The United Kingdom Warehousing Association’s Awards are established as symbols of achievement in the 3PL sector and emphasise the importance of logistics within today’s economy, and this year UKWA received a record number of entries in all categories.

A total of 10 UKWA Awards were presented by the event’s celebrity host, Gerald Ratner.
